Whitening teeth after filling in a chipped tooth?
I never whitened my teeth frequently, but about 8 months ago i chipped my front tooth and the dentist put whatever it is on the bottom of it to fill it in. I would like to whiten my teeth again (with just the strips) but I'm afraid that the part of my tooth that was chipped will change a different color than the rest of my tooth. Anyone know if it's possible to whiten teeth that have been filled after being chipped? I don't wanna screw up my front tooth. lol Thanks!
--------------------
The bonding that was used to fill in your chipped tooth will not whiten. If you whiten your teeth now, your natural teeth will turn whiter, but the bonding will stay the same color. So if you whiten the bonding will become very apparent.

The most common option used as homemade teeth whitening agent is baking soda, which has a mild bleaching action. Given that it is used in baking, it also implies safety. Baking soda is sprinkled on the toothbrush, and teeth then cleaned using a gentle, circular motion. Care should still be taken though, especially for people with gum sensitivity. Old wives' recipes often state that a paste of baking powder, a little salt, and a few drops of white vinegar, works effectively. Salt, used exactly as baking soda, is also touted as being a good teeth whitener. However, it might just be its osmosis, dehydrating action that makes teeth appear whiter, since dehydrated teeth look whiter. Lemon juice is often used, but it had high acidic levels, so teeth can weaken in the long run. Other natural, fruit options regard rubbing the inside of an orange peel on the teeth. A strawberry cut in half and the inside rubbed on teeth also works. Mashed strawberry can also be applied with a toothbrush. Apple cider vinegar is also said to be effective. does anybody know a homebrew for teeth whitening ?
I drink a lot of green tea, and it has stained my teeth. I dont want to go out and buy teeth whiteners, or go have them professionally whitened. So does anybody know of any home recipes to help me out with this ?
--------------------
For the millionth time... The main ingredient in Crest Whitestrips AND in what they use to professionally bleach your teeth at the dentists office is: Hydrogen Peroxide. You can buy plain old generic Hydrogen Peroxide over the counter for super cheap. Just swish it around in your mouth for at least a minute twice a day and spit it out. It may take awhile to see results but it's a cheaper version of Crest Whitening Rinse which is essentially mint-flavored Hydrogen Peroxide.
